Understanding Budget Laptops
Budget laptops are designed to be affordable and accessible. They typically cost less than $700 and are suitable for basic development tasks. These laptops are ideal for students, hobbyists, or developers just starting out.
Advantages of Budget Laptops
- Lower cost, making them accessible for most budgets
- Lightweight and portable design
- Decent battery life for everyday use
- Simple, user-friendly interfaces
Limitations of Budget Laptops
- Limited processing power, unsuitable for heavy multitasking or virtualization
- Lower-quality displays and build materials
- Less durable components, which may affect longevity
- Fewer options for high-end specifications like dedicated GPUs
Understanding Premium Laptops
Premium laptops generally cost over $1,000 and offer high-end specifications, superior build quality, and advanced features. They are tailored for professional developers who require robust performance and reliability.
Advantages of Premium Laptops
- Powerful processors capable of handling complex tasks
- High-resolution, color-accurate displays
- Durable, premium build quality
- Enhanced battery life and fast charging capabilities
- Options for dedicated graphics cards for GPU-intensive tasks
Limitations of Premium Laptops
- Higher initial cost, which may be prohibitive for some
- Heavier and less portable than budget options
- Potentially overpowered for simple tasks, leading to unnecessary expenses
- Higher repair and upgrade costs
What’s Worth It for Full Stack Developers?
The decision depends on your specific needs, budget, and career stage. For beginners or those on a tight budget, a mid-range or budget laptop may suffice. However, for professional developers working on complex projects, premium laptops can provide significant advantages in performance and longevity.
Factors to Consider
- Performance Needs: Do you run virtual machines, Docker containers, or intensive IDEs?
- Portability: Will you travel frequently or work remotely?
- Longevity: Are you looking for a device that will last several years?
- Budget Constraints: What is your maximum affordable investment?
Recommendations
- Budget Option: Look for laptops with at least an Intel i5 or AMD Ryzen 5 processor, 8GB RAM, and SSD storage.
- Premium Option: Consider laptops with Intel i7 or i9, 16GB or more RAM, dedicated GPU, and high-resolution displays.
Ultimately, investing in a premium laptop can be worthwhile for full stack developers who need consistent, high-level performance and plan to work on demanding applications regularly. Budget laptops serve well for learning, light development, and initial projects but may fall short for professional, long-term use.
